How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Brentwood?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
Brentwood Studio Apartments | $1,263 | $1,142 | $1,365 |
Brentwood 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,421 | $900 | $1,813 |
Brentwood 2 Bedroom Apartments | $1,530 | $975 | $2,413 |
Brentwood 3 Bedroom Apartments | $1,530 | $1,200 | $2,091 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Low Income Brentwood Apartments
How much is the average rent for a Low Income Brentwood Apartment?
The average rent for a Low Income Apartment in Brentwood is $1,217.
What is the largest Low Income Brentwood Apartment for rent?
Today's Low Income apartment with the most square footage in Brentwood is a 1,040 square feet unit starting from $985 at Oak Hill Village Apartments.
What is the average size for Brentwood Low Income Apartments for rent?
The average size for a Low Income rental in Brentwood is currently at 687 sq ft.
